General
We are looking for Cloud DevOps Engineers to join our client’s team and support the migration of their application portfolio to a new cloud platform, aligned with industry-standard cloud principles.
Responsibilities/Activities
- Contribute to and support the migration of applications to the new cloud platform (Gen2)
- Carry out full application transformation and implement comprehensive CI/CD practices
- Apply a CD approach for automated deliveries and automated OCS/VCS environment reconstructions through scripting
- Monitor the correct functioning of applications and infrastructure
- Adjust technical resources (CPU, RAM, etc.) based on requirements.
- Create and delete environments as needed
- Support the implementation of new infrastructure for any new application added to the application portfolio
- Update and maintain environments, including applying security patches.
- Understand the new platform, its services, and tool sets, and continually develop relevant skills
- Train and support users on the methodology, platform, tools, and scripts.
- Facilitate the transformation of applications to the cloud and foster DevOps practices
- Assist in drafting application migration documentation
- Collaborate with local IT teams, head office IT teams, technical architects, and infrastructure providers
- Implement FinOps principles to optimize resource usage
- Contribute to risk analysis
- Engage in infrastructure projects, providing technical guidance in line with the client’s best practices, guidelines, instructions, and recommendations
Requirements
Technical
- At least 4 years of experience working on projects in Cloud, DevOps, and containerization environments
- Strong understanding of both public and private cloud platforms
- Proficiency with key CI/CD tools, including Jenkins Pipelines, SonarQube, Docker, Git, Ansible, Puppet, Terraform, Kubernetes, Nexus, and ElasticSearch
- Familiarity with a range of technologies, such as Dynatrace, Splunk, Kibana, PostgreSQL, Logstash, Java, Tomcat, .NET Framework, Linux RedHat, and Windows
- Experience with load balancing solutions, resiliency, and observability tools
- Solid knowledge of cloud security principles and tools
- Understanding of configuration management and deployment best practices
Education
- University degree in Computer Science or other related fields
Others
- Good oral and written communication skills (English and Romanian)
- Analytical and team spirit, rigor, autonomy, organized, positive communication
- Carry out your activity independently, be a source of suggestions throughout the entire activity
- Ability to write communications and meeting minutes and ability to write expressions of needs